Partizan Stadium, Belgrade; 25th of August, 2011.

Shamrock Rovers made Irish footballing history with a momentous 2-1 away victory over Serbian giants Partizan Belgrade at the Partizan Stadium in Belgrade. The result made the score 3-2 on aggregate and put Rovers into the group stage of the 2011-12 Europa League for the first time in their history; they were also the first Irish club ever to qualify for the group stage of a major European club competition.

Vladimir Volkov headed Partizan into a 1-0 lead after 35 minutes, only for Pat Sullivan to equalise for the Irish side with a stunning wonder-goal on 58 minutes. Rovers then won a penalty after the game went into extra-time and Stephen O'Donnell converted to ensure Rovers passage through to the group stage with only minutes to play. This away goal meant that Partizan would have had to have scored two goals without reply in the remaining six minutes to go through at Rovers' expense, but it was not to be for the Serbian side.
